“It is no harm, pay no attention to it.” When the barber explained that his son was saying that his house was on fire, Khosrove silenced him by roaring, “it is no harm.” At the end of the story, uncle Khosrove again became irritated and shouted at farmer John Byro to be quiet. He said, “Your horse has been returned.
